Crik: England says no to non-neutral umpires in Ashes
(Updates to include Ponting quotes)
By John Coomber, Senior Sports Writer
SYDNEY, Aug 28 AAP - England has rebuffed an Australian proposal that the best umpires
in the world stand in this summer's Ashes series, regardless of nationality.
Although no formal approach was made, Test captain Ricky Ponting and other Australian
cricket officials believe the Ashes showdown should be controlled by the top umpires on
the ICC's elite panel, even if they are Australian or English.
Under ICC guidelines, Test matches must be controlled by neutral umpires.
